Liverpool consider shock move for Crystal Palace boss Glasner

In a stunning development that could reshape the Premier League managerial landscape, Crystal Palace boss Oliver Glasner has emerged as a genuine contender for the Liverpool job as the search for Jürgen Klopp's successor takes an unexpected turn.

The Austrian manager, who only arrived at Selhurst Park in February, has impressed Liverpool's decision-makers with his transformative impact at Palace and his proven track record in European football, most notably leading Eintracht Frankfurt to Europa League glory in 2022.

FSG's Expanding Shortlist

Liverpool's ownership group Fenway Sports Group, working alongside incoming sporting director Richard Hughes, had initially focused on Feyenoord's Arne Slot as the leading candidate. However, multiple sources now confirm that Glasner has entered serious consideration following his remarkable start in South London.

The 49-year-old's reputation for implementing aggressive, high-pressing systems and developing young talent aligns perfectly with Liverpool's established philosophy, making him an increasingly attractive option for the Anfield hierarchy.

Palace's Remarkable Transformation

Since replacing Roy Hodgson, Glasner has overseen a dramatic improvement in Crystal Palace's performances, culminating in yesterday's spectacular 5-2 demolition of West Ham. The victory showcased the brand of attacking football that has caught Liverpool's attention, with the Eagles scoring four goals in the opening 31 minutes.

Under Glasner's guidance, Palace have taken 13 points from his seven home matches, with his tactical flexibility and man-management skills drawing praise from players and pundits alike.

The Slot Factor

While Glasner's stock rises, Feyenoord manager Arne Slot remains very much in the frame. The Dutchman's work in Rotterdam, including last season's Eredivisie title triumph, has established him as one of Europe's most sought-after coaches.

However, Liverpool are conducting thorough due diligence on multiple candidates, with Glasner's Premier League experience and immediate impact potentially giving him an edge in the final decision-making process.
